Moses::NBestOptions Struct Reference

#include <NBestOptions.h>

Inheritance diagram for Moses::NBestOptions:

Inheritance graph
[legend]
Collaboration diagram for Moses::NBestOptions:

Collaboration graph
[legend]

List of all members.

Public Member Functions

bool init (Parameter const &param)
bool update (std::map< std::string, xmlrpc_c::value >const &param)
 NBestOptions ()

Public Attributes

size_t nbest_size
size_t factor
bool enabled
bool print_trees
bool only_distinct
bool include_alignment_info
bool include_segmentation
bool include_feature_labels
bool include_passthrough
bool include_all_factors
std::string output_file_path


Detailed Description

Definition at line 8 of file NBestOptions.h.


Constructor & Destructor Documentation

Moses::NBestOptions::NBestOptions (  ) 

Definition at line 9 of file NBestOptions.cpp.


Member Function Documentation

bool Moses::NBestOptions::init ( Parameter const &  param  ) 

bool Moses::NBestOptions::update ( std::map< std::string, xmlrpc_c::value >const &  param  ) 

Definition at line 68 of file NBestOptions.cpp.


Member Data Documentation

Definition at line 11 of file NBestOptions.h.

Referenced by init().

Definition at line 16 of file NBestOptions.h.

Referenced by init(), and Moses::Manager::OutputNBest().

Definition at line 21 of file NBestOptions.h.

Referenced by init(), and Moses::Manager::OutputNBest().

Definition at line 18 of file NBestOptions.h.

Referenced by init().

Definition at line 19 of file NBestOptions.h.

Referenced by init().

Definition at line 17 of file NBestOptions.h.

Referenced by init(), and Moses::Manager::OutputNBest().

Definition at line 23 of file NBestOptions.h.

Referenced by init().

Definition at line 13 of file NBestOptions.h.

Referenced by init().


The documentation for this struct was generated from the following files:

Generated on Thu Jul 6 00:33:26 2017 for Moses by  doxygen 1.5.9